>> For what it's worth, every few years, we survey the seniors at 5 area high
>> schools to assess the long-term impact of their pre-teen experiences at the
>> Sciencenter (many haven't visited for 5-6 years). For anyone interested, we
>> have a few data points comparing various outcomes with the number of visits.
>> Some of the visits are field trips and others family trips, so these data
>> don't really answer the question about field trips.
>>
>> A paper on this from the ILR is at www.sciencenter.org/AboutUs/MuseumTools
>> (first item).
